    Identify and Engage Your Pivotal Talent

    Webcast: August 4, 2009

    Who constitutes your pivotal talent pool? Are you sure you know? Use the well known Disney example: Compare the employees who play the Disney characters at Disneyworld with the sweepers in the park. According to Disney, the role of the people playing the characters is fairly prescribed; there is limited scope for individual interpretation, and much of the variability is engineered out. However, with the park sweepers, a big part of their role is unrelated to sweeping -- they can identify when guests are having problems and improve the overall quality of the experience. The park sweepers, then, are a pivotal talent because their performance has a dramatic impact on guests. Can you identify your pivotal talent? Is it your C-level leaders, your high performing individuals, or another, perhaps overlooked, group?

    This webcast will look at how we identify our talent and help us to overcome our myopic perceptions-- focusing on groups and people who are truly high impact to your customers, suppliers and the bottom line. more »
